Jordan visa requirements for Turkish citizens
Visa-free · up to 90 days
Maximum stay: 90 days per entry
Visa rules change without notice. Always confirm with the embassy, consulate or the official government source linked above before you book or travel.
Passport validity requirement
Your passport must be valid for at least 6 months from your arrival date.
About Jordan for visitors
Jordan is the gateway to iconic Middle Eastern heritage—Petra's rose-red cliffs, the Dead Sea's mineral waters, and the Wadi Rum desert. Visitors typically combine ancient Nabatean ruins with natural wonders in a compact geography, making it ideal for short heritage and adventure trips.
Queen Alia International Airport (AMM) south of Amman is the main entry point, with smaller services at Aqaba. Immigration is efficient and visitor-friendly; staff speak English, and ground arrangements for desert camps or heritage tours can often be made immediately post-arrival.
